#ec080f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ec080f is composed of 92.5% red, 3.1%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 358.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 47.8%. #ec080f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ff101e with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

Shades and Tints of #ec080f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080001 is the darkest color, while #fff4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ec080f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7979 is the less saturated color, while #ec080f is the most saturated one.
